But the new study, an … WebMay 8, 2024 · It's best to stop giving your baby bottles between ages 1 and 2. By a year old, your baby is getting their nutritional needs met with daytime meals and snacks, so they don't need the calories from breast milk or formula to get them through the night. If you're breastfeeding, there's no need to wean your child completely yet.

WebApr 8, 2024 · Newborn to 12-month-old babies use an “immature swallow” pattern (also known as a “tongue thrust swallow”) to receive nourishment by sucking either a breast or bottle. However, as a baby approaches 12 months old, the immature swallow becomes ready to mature. WebLimit your child's milk intake to 16–24 ounces (480–720 milliliters) a day. Include iron-rich foods in your child's diet, like meat, poultry, fish, beans, and iron-fortified foods. Continue serving iron-fortified cereal until your child is eating a variety of iron-rich foods.
WebAfter 1 year, breast milk alone does not provide all the nutrients a growing child needs. So solid foods must become a regular part of the diet. ...
